    The above image shows the result of a product search where we get featured in the Google Shop Now box. The others get 'Free Delivery' next to their entry, but we don't. How can we fix that?

    I suspect the information is being picked up by Google from the Google Product Search Feeder results. Our store typically has flat $15 shipping for most items, and free shipping for items over $1,000.

    Does anyone know if there a way to flag items over $1,000 as being free delivery in the feed, or in the Merchant Centre settings?

    Some more research and I think I’ve fixed this issue.

    Seems nothing is put into the feed about shipping costs. So it must all be done by rules in the Merchant Centre.

    I’ve just made changes to those rules, so hopefully the shipping rates will now be handled properly.

    Quote Originally Posted by echexxxxxxxx10 View Post
    hello and thanks for the reply, yes, I see all the settings, I put 777 on the feed directory, but after 14 hours still no file was generated, how do I set the cron? can you help me?
    thank you
    OK, so some basics. Have you gone through all the settings in the menu "Configuration....Google Merchant Center Feeder Configuration" and have your output directory set, and some included categories for products?

    What happens when you go to "Tools...Google Merchant Feeder" and you press confirm? You should get something like:

    Code:
    Google Merchant Center Feeder v1.14.5 started 2019/02/27 11:44:35
    
    Feed file - /home/user/public_html/mysite.com/feed/google/my_products_en.xml
    
    Processing: Feed - Yes, Upload - No
    
    Google Merchant Center File Complete In 13.232373 Seconds 631 of 2894 Records
    There's no point trying to set up a Cron job until that part works and you see an available file under "Tools...Google Merchant Feeder" with some records in it. Setting up a Cron job will depend on your particular host, and if you're not comfortable doing that, you might want to get help from your service provider. For example, the command for the job on my apache server is something like: wget 'http://mysite.com/googlefroogle.php?feed=fy_un_tp&key=MYGOOGLEMERCHANTKEY' and you'll need to set a time/frequency for the job to run on the server, which I do through my cpanel cron jobs applet.
